SBS’s “Athena” suffers a drop in viewer ratings

SBS’s “Athena” suffered a sharp drop in viewer ratings due to the 2011 AFC Asian Cup semi-final clash between South Korea and Japan, which aired in the same time slot.
According to AGB Nielsen Media Research, the January 25th episode recorded only a 5.4% in viewer ratings, which is a 9.4% drop from its 14.8% record on the 24th.
Meanwhile, MBC’s “Queen of Reversals” recorded 13.8%.
But the 2011 AFC Asian Cup was not the only reason for the drama’s dismal ratings.

“Athena’s” main actors, Jung Woo Sung and Jung Chan Woo, suffered injuries from a recent car accident on set, forcing shooting to be stopped. The drama was thus forced to air a side story special, featuring behind-the-scenes footage as well as memorable scenes chosen by the cast themselves.

Meanwhile, the 2011 AFC Asian Cup recorded 37.7% in viewer ratings due to the intense match between South Korea and Japan. Korea’s dreams of winning first place crashed out after they lost 0-3 in the penalty shootout; the team had been locked in a 2-2 tie with Japan after extra time.

Korea will face Uzbekistan in the 3rd place playoff on January 28th after the latter was trashed 0-6 by Australia in the other semi-final. The final will take place a day later.

Heechul confirms that Super Junior has renewed contracts with SME

Amidst the contract controversies involving TVXQ/JYJ, Super Junior’s Hangeng and most recently Kara, SuJu member Heechul revealed today that he, along with his fellow members, have decided to renew their contracts with SM Entertainment.
On the January 19th radio broadcast of MBC’s Golden Fishery, Heechul stated, “Not long ago, I re-signed my contract with my agency.Kim Gu Ra inquired, “Is that good news?” and Yong Jong Shin enviously quipped, “It means he’s received a lump sum. A lump sum,” drawing laughter.
Heechul also revealed that the rest of Super Junior had also decided to re-sign their contracts with SM Entertainment last November on his SBS radio program, Kim Heechul’s Young Street. The idol expressed his faith in SME, stating, “A man must live with loyalty.”
Heechul isn’t the first SME artist to talk about their statuses with SME; a few weeks ago, fellow bandmate Siwon and singer BoA spoke up about their hard work as artists and discomfort with the term ’slave contract.’

SHINee’s Jonghyun received surgery on his left leg

News of SHINee’s Jonghyun receiving surgery on his leg were delayed in being reported to the media.
Jonghyun previously injured his left ankle on October of 2010, after the group was rushed by fans at the Jakarta airport upon their arrival. Although he thought it was okay, further examinations showed that he required surgery.
Jonghyun received surgery on his left leg at a hospital in Seoul on January 17th. Through Star News, a representative of SM Entertainment revealed on the 20th, “Jonghyun received surgery on the 17th, and it concluded safely. He’s currently in good condition.
Due to his recovery, he will not be performing at the “20th Seoul Music Awards” (scheduled for the 20th), and SHINee will be performing as a four-member group.

Five idol taboos broken by the ‘Big Space Star’ Kim Heechul

Within five years of his debut, Super Junior’s Kim Heechul has not only skyrocketed to fame, but he’s also become a formidable star in the celebrity stratosphere.
Heechul first debuted as a member of Super Junior back in 2005, and caught everyone’s attention with his pretty boy looks.  Producers from the acting industry were quick to cast this handsome rookie, which eventually landed him a role in KBS’s “Banolim.” From the start of his career, Heechul doubled his potential by walking on dual paths as an actor and a singer.
But it’s not only his career choices alone that made his star rise.
Perhaps it’s because he was born in the natural and carefree city of Kwangwon-do, but Heechul has never hesitated to express his thoughts nor compromise his bright and outgoing personality. Although this soon became the reason why he’s developed a strong fanbase, it’s also given birth a lot of anti-fans as well.
Despite it all, he’s managed to reach the sixth year of his career today, and is still the same confident person fans fell in love with from the start; now the general public is finally beginning to recognize his genuine merit.
He’s managed to turn his antis into fans, all the while breaking the taboos laid against idol singers.  Star News came up with the ‘Top 5′ taboos that Heechul’s moved against, which are as follows:
1. He calls himself the ‘Big Space Star,’ and managed to go up against gagman Kim Gura.
Before the arrival of Heechul, the virtue of idols was strict modesty. Idols were expected to scream “No!” once complimented, whether it be for their looks, talents, or whatever else was being referred to.
But Heechul was different.  He confidently declared, “I am kind of handsome.“  Although this statement brought him many antis, his ‘consistent cockiness’ through the past five years has ironically engrained a sense of sincere honesty; something that even antis couldn’t argue against.
Now, when he declares himself as a ‘big space star’ on broadcast programs, nobody crinkles their face in disagreement, but laughs along, amused.
His confidence was even seen before Kim Gura, who’s notorious for his harsh remarks. Heechul regarded him with respect, while at the same time, expressing all that he wanted. Such confidence earned him an honorable high five from the gagman.
Heechul commented, “I’m not really a respectful child, but I never hide myself from others. It’s the same from when I addressed Gura-hyung.  He does give way for me a lot, but what I think is personally weird is that I’m a great fan of the harsh criticisms Gura and Myungsu-hyung dishes out.  Maybe because they’re confident as well? (laughter)”
2. The first voice imitation of SM’s Lee Soo Man, was of course, done by none other than Heechul.
Heechul’s fearlessness has made even SM representatives surprised over his actions. Moments after his debut, Heechul did a voice imitation of SM’s producer, Lee Soo Man, that not only surprised his manager, but representatives alike, as it was the first time any star attempted such an act.
He explained, “On a broadcast show, I did once imitate his voice.  I did it to have some fun, but my manager hyungs acted really shocked and discussed in length with the PDs about whether to let it go out on broadcast or not.  I called Lee Soo Man and asked, ‘I imitated your voice in a positive way. This can be aired, right?’  He said, ‘Sure, I trust that our Heechul is a respectful child.  I could say no, but that will make you do it more, so just let it air.’  Ever since then, many different SM stars have imitated his voice (laughter).”

3. Despite being an SM star, he’s often seen on broadcast programs saying, “YG and JYP, fighting!
The rivalry between the top three, SME, JYPE, and YGE, is known by any Korean music fan.  Although it’s a competition created with good will, artists have always been seen rooting for their own labels in public programs.
Asked about his favorite girl group member, Heechul didn’t choose an SM labelmate, but the Wonder GirlsSohee from JYPE.   SNSD’s Yoona later retorted, “Oppa, why do you only like Sohee?”  He replied back, “You’re closer with 2PM than you are with me!
Recently, at his “Young Street” radio program, he even sang a song from 1TYM and shouted out, “YG Family, peace! Fighting!“    Because fans know that he loves the SM family more than anyone else, they’re able to laugh off such cute antics in good humor.
4. Being an idol himself, he once claimed, “There’s too much idol music.  I hope band music makes a comeback.
Although he’s nearly 29 years old now, Heechul is still one of the representative idol figures.  But for such an idol to exclaim on a radio broadcast, “In our country’s broadcast industry, idol music is too strong.  I hope band music and other varieties of genres will receive much love as well.
As a radio DJ, he comes across not only popular music, but a wider variety of genres as well.  Through his experience, he claimed that he realized the only way for people to genuinely love and become interested in idol music is for other genres to receive just as much love.
5. The public easily understands why he calls himself BoA’s brother and labels IU as a “singer song student.”
It’s rare to see anyon treat Asia’s star, BoA, with such fearlessness because of her stature.  As you’ve guessed by now, Kim Heechul is the exception.  He once claimed on a radio show that BoA has impressive drinking skills, which BoA was able to laugh off because she knows his personality better than anyone else.  To music fans, they’ve become affectionately known as the ‘angry siblings.’
Heechul’s fearlessness doesn’t end there, though; his new target is the nation’s new little sister, IU.  Before IU hit it big with “Good Day,” she used to appear as a fixed guest on his radio program.  She received the nickname “singer song student” by Heechul, which he explained to mean a high school student with exceptional talents in music.
Heechul commented, “BoA is like my little sibling.  When we’re together, we treat each other with both warmth and swears (laughter).  And IU used to have a difficult time regarding me, but now she’s become a great little sister.  It might be hard to believe, but I do get shy around new people.  Even so, once I get close with someone, I stick by them until the end.  This personality has worked well in getting close with BoA and IU (laughter).”

SHINee, Shin Seung Hoon & Son Ho Young perform at the “Korea Friendship Concert” in Australia

Sydney, Australia was visited by the Hallyu Wave on January 12th with the “Korea Friendship Concert” at the Town Hall.
SHINee, Shin Seung Hoon, and Son Ho Young attended the concert as representatives of Korea and showed off the charms of K-pop music with their performances.
Fans were reported to have crowded the Town Hall since the early morning in order to catch glimpses of the stars before their performances, and over 30 different news agencies, including broadcast channel SBS, attended the press conference held before the concert.   The concert managed to gather a 2,500 member audience of all ages for a ‘mini-concert’ style performance from each of the attending artists.
The fact that the Town Hall even opened its doors to Korean pop music, as it only allows classical concerts, is an exceptional feat in itself that shows the power of K-pop.
The concert will broadcast through Arirang TV’s “The M Wave” in over 188 different broadcasting stations around the world at 6 PM on January 23rd.

Ticket sales for SuJu’s “The 3rd Asia Tour Super show 3 in Taipei” are a big hit

Super Junior has once again confirmed their explosive popularity in Taiwan through the heavy influx of sales for their two-day ‘The 3rd Asia Tour Super show 3 in Taipei’ concert, to be held on March 12th and 13th of 2011.
Ticket reservations were initially only restricted to people with memberships, but the reservations were all sold out after only a few days. Tickets for general fans without memberships began selling on January 10th.
Fans used ticket sale systems online and ticket shops to purchase their tickets, which quickly led to selling a total of 6000 tickets.
However, due to the vast influx of ticket orders, many fans are currently experiencing difficulties in trying to get hold of a concert ticket through the online ticket sales system. Fans have expressed their dissatisfaction with the concert management service, as the online system is taking $5 USD more than the original price.
“We lost control of the sudden situation and the ticket sales system is currently suffering some difficulties. We are cooperating the best we can to call each consumer regarding replacement tickets. The total number of admission tickets has not changed, and the concert has not yet been sold out,” stated a representative.
It seems like the chance of a fan getting hold of a ticket has been greatly reduced, as the representative said, “Currently, it is difficult for fans to purchase a concert ticket.”

Kyuhyun interview with PlayDB Magazine “The Three Musketeers”

“The kid I’m looking for, you can’t see him easily and he’s able to see the wide world. He loves small grass leaves.”
When I was on my way back home from watching Kyuhyun’s debut stage as the clumsy country bumpkin D’Artagnan in The Three Musketeers, I thought of Camomile’s song The Kid I’m Looking For. Kyuhyun, the thirteenth member of Super Junior is currently working as a musical actor. The innocent young man Kyuhyun is living happily as D’Artagnan and has fallen in love with charms of musical curtain calls. Kyuhyun who says he’s “Now somewhat used to the highly technical ad libs from the sunbaes” started the interview with his feeling about his musical debut claiming, “For the first four performances, I was getting angry with myself.”
 With <The Three Musketeers> as the start, you began your musical career.
I did my first performance on December 21st. Including the afternoon performances, I did four performances for three days in a row. At that time, I got angry with myself. I regretted it thinking, “Why did I do it like that?” In the beginning, I didn’t fully understand and I was swamped. Fortunately, because there were people who encouraged me, I’m able to stand here today. Now, I have my own character and I don’t know about compliments, but I don’t get angry with myself anymore. (laughs)
You need to do ad libs during the musical. I’m sure there are many occasions when unexpected things happen.
There’s a scene where D’Artagnan goes down to the audience to complete the missions in order to become a musketeer. At first, I simply did ad libs. One time, I got a mission saying that I have to kiss an audience member. I was thinking about what to do and in the end, I couldn’t do it and just returned to the stage. Now, I have my own method. I can do anything and everything now. (laughs) One time, during the scene where Jussac and D’Artagna have a duel, the audio went out. At that moment, I was thinking, “Is this a rehearsal?” So, I was going to ask, “Hyung, what are we going to do?” But before doing that, I thought, “Ah, I shouldn’t do that!” So, I just started. The sunbaes told me that I did good. (laughs) I think that I can react to situations more quickly now.
There are a lot of reviews saying, “Kyuhyun was D’Artagnan.”
Didn’t fans write that? I often read performance reviews and there are three types of reviews. Half of them are my fans complimenting me and half of them are people who love musicals. There are also people who comment that it was either unexpectedly good or that there are big differences between me and the other actors. On the days when I think I did badly or I’m really tired doing The Three Musketeers, I read reviews from the fans. They really give me strength because it makes me think, “Even with this performance, they are cheering me on.” Some audiences said that they didn’t expect many things because an idol singer was going to appear. But after seeing the musical, they said it was unexpectedly good. Others pointed out that I have bad vibrations and that my vocalization is not suited for musicals.
I’ve heard that even veteran actors don’t read reviews they are demoralizing.
Of course I get hurt sometimes. But I know they are a big help to me. There are a lot of people who leave malicious comments about me. Those who leave malicious comments and attack some other aspects about me regardless of whether I sing, act or appear on variety shows. But the audiences who write musical reviews give me advice after watching my musical performances. They are not people who just hate me. They talk about things that they didn’t like after seeing my performance. I like them because I can learn about things I need to fix.
Did you ever see other D’Artagnan’s (Uhm Kijoon, Kim Mooyeol and Jay) performance?
I really wanted to see them all, but I was only able to see Mooyeol hyung’s D’Artagnan because of my schedule. I saw it before starting my first performance. I learned a lot from it thinking, “Hyung interpreted it like that.” It’s amazing because each scene is different the way the actors interpret it differently. When I saw the performance, it was more like watching Kim Mooyeol’s The Three Musketeers and following his movement rather than watching the musical The Three Musketeers. (laughs)
I’m sure there were big burdens on you.
It was difficult at first for a lot of reasons. It wasn’t like I got the role through an audition. Also, I got a big role in my first work that I felt sorry and burdensome. So, I worked hard and the sunbaes saw that and helped me a lot. Mooyeol hyung even came to the practice room when he didn’t need to and he taught me everything after watching me practice.
There are a lot of veteran actors including Kim Bubrae and Seo Bumsuk.
Bumsuk hyung told me to just talk loudly. I normally talk softly and he told that I can’t do that in musicals. He told me to talk loudly even if the line says I have to speak softly. (laughs) I was really confused and Kim Bubrae sunbaenim told me to stand still. He said if the actor’s nervous, the audience will become more nervous. He told me not to look so nervous even if I am. When I was practicing, after each scene, the sunbaenims came and coached me on how to do the scenes.
Ah, sounds like it must have caused a lot of stress. (laughs)
Not at all. When I heard that I was cast in The Three Musketeers, I was thinking if I should learn acting separately. Suju member Yesung hyung said, “Being taught in the practice room by the hyungs who do musicals are the most accurate.” I was worried thinking, “What if they don’t want to teach me?” But the sunbaes taught me closely that it was really good.
Singing was more easy, right?
I received a lot of criticism for my singing as well. (laughs) I still had my habit that I had singing on Gayo stage. When I sing, I have to act too. But I received some comments that I only sing. That was difficult. If I want to continue working as a musical actor, that problem is something I have to solve.
Doing the musical, when were you most proud of yourself?
Super Junior is a group that has more than 10 members. (laughs) Since I’m the maknae, I didn’t receive a lot of spotlight. With the musical, I receive a lot of spotlight. So, in that aspect I like it. (laughs) I can’t forget the feeling of inspiration I received in my first performance. Curtain calls are touching with every performance. In that moment when I’m saying hello, it feels like I’m Kyuhyun and not D’Artagnan. There’s also a feeling of “I did it” that I get overwhelmed. When I stand on stage as D’Artagnan, it’s really fun. I think it’s more more fun doing musical than singing on stage as a singer. (laughs) I think it was really a good decision to do the musical.
I’ve heard that Composer Yoo Youngsuk said, “You are a genius. Where did you come from?” It was a late discovery of Kyuhyun.
Sigh. I’m not a genius or anything like that. Yoo Youngsuk sunbaenim helped making Super Junior’s third album. During that time, he paid close attention to me. Before the third album, you couldn’t see me because the members who primarily danced stood in the front while the members who sang stood in the back. After the third album, Sorry Sorry, I sang in the front and there were many opportunities to show myself on the variety programs.
Vocal trainer Park Sunjoo said, “I saw Kyuhyun’s potentials first” which received a lot of interest.
I was always interested in singing as I was the band vocal in my middle school. Before becoming a singer, I tried out for a singing competition called Buddy Buddy Gayo Contest to win the reward money. (laughs) I met teacher Park Sunjoo through that contest. The sunbaenim wanted to work with me. So, I just said yes and waited for her. Afterward, SM contacted me, but I told them that I have already decided to work with teacher Park Sunjoo and kept waiting for her to contact me. But that was when she was singing A Man And A Woman with Kim Bumsoo sunbaenim. I couldn’t get in touch with her. Finally, I contacted SM and asked if they are still willing to accept me. That’s how I joined Super Junior. (laughs)
What kind of a singer or a musical actor do you want to be?
I don’t think now is the time for me to discuss what kind of a singer or a musical actor I want to be. (Yesung told me he really wants to do Jekyll and Hyde.) I think it’s too rash to think about that now. Haha. I have to focus on my singing career and if I’m given the chance to do another muscial, I’m going to do it with full of passion. Now, I’m only thinking about The Three Musketeers because I think I can do other work later. If I did a good job, wouldn’t other producers hire me? If there’s no talk about that when I’m done with The Three Musketeers. Hmm~(laughs) I want to finish The Three Musketeers well!

Which Artists' Album Sold the Best in 2010?

Today the list of the best-selling Korean albums of 2010 have been released. Artists such as SHINee, SNSD and Super Junior are listed on it. Check out if your favourite artist is on the list!
SNSD tops the list of the female and all artists with 312,000 album sales in 2010. Following SNSD is Super Junior with a sale number of 263,000. On the 3rd spot is SHINee with 155,000 album sales.
Check out the whole lists below!
Male:
1. Super Junior 263,000
2. SHINee 155,000
3. JYJ 128,000
4. BEAST 112,000
5. 2PM 107,000
6. 2AM 96,000
7. SS501 49,000
8. CN Blue 44,000
9. Brown Eyed Soul 43,000
10. TVXQ 40,000
Female:
1. SNSD 312,000
2. 2NE1 64,000
3. Kara 54,000
4. T-ara 26,000
5. f(x) 17,000
Overall:
1. SNSD 312,000
2. Super Junior 263,000
3. SHINee 155,000
4. JYJ 128,000
5. BEAST 112,000
6. 2PM 107,000
7. 2AM 96,000
8. 2NE1 64,000
9. BoA 63,000
10. Kara 54,000
